Onboarding note for the Marrowgate payments service. Our integration tests are flaky mainly around the settlement mock, which races the clock-advance helper. Always run the suite with the deterministic scheduler flag; without it, roughly one run in ten fails on timeout. Never merge on a retried green build without checking the flake log. To access the quarantined test credentials vault for local runs, use the recovery passphrase provided below.

strongbox words: wenix-ulador

**Runbook — QuillWiki RBAC repair** If role assignments stop propagating on QuillWiki: restart the perms worker, confirm the role cache cleared, re-run `sync-roles`. If the worker exits immediately, its env file is missing the directory bind credential — common after a fresh node join. Check `/etc/quillwiki/.env` on the affected node. The worker needs this exact line present in that file:

env line for fafof-fahag: LEDGER_TOKEN5=f8790

**Q: Why do some seats show as grey in the StageGrid renderer?**

Grey usually means the seat-map cache hasn't synced with the Velmora box office feed yet. It's not a bug, just a lag — give it ten minutes before escalating. If a customer calls about the Orpharion Theatre specifically, check whether their event was remapped last week, since a few balcony blocks got renumbered. Full troubleshooting steps, cache-flush instructions, and the escalation path live on the internal wiki page below.

wiki page, tahaf-tajog: https://jira.ordindyn.corp/pipeline